Postby BH_Stag » Tue Aug 21, 2018 9:09 pm

Dissappointed in that second half, we never get going at all but then get a huge chance to win it. Walkers got to be taking those going forward if we want to be at the top end. Think we looked a bit sluggish, particularly Benning and think Davies had an off night too.

Couple of other gripes, we’re nowhere near effective enough when attacking corners - would like to see some work done on that. Also would like to see Khan left on until the end, he’s that player that is capable of creating something from nothing and winning you a game, players like that should be left on in my opinion.

Plus points are we are still unbeaten and Tranmere on a Tuesday was never going to be an easy fixture. Even when we’re not at our best we do get chances.

Also Olejnik looked very assured tonight, was pleased to see him take his chance.
Credit to Flitcroft for the Benning sub too, identified the weakness and sorted it.
